Abstract
The invention discloses a sinking type liftable enclosure for a ship deck opening, which comprises: a fence base; the lifting mechanism comprises at least two lifting mechanisms, and a circle of high-level rod is arranged at the top end of each lifting mechanism; a plurality of rings of middle rods which are arranged below the high-position rods in parallel and connected with the lifting mechanism; at least two brace bar mechanisms. The supporting rod mechanism is used for supporting the raised fence, and not only is the operation and the storage convenient, but also the stability and the safety of the guardrail are good.

Technical Field
The invention relates to a submerged type liftable enclosure for a ship deck opening.
Background
At present, the opening is required to be added to the deck built on part of ships to meet the requirement of ship lifting spare parts, the spare parts can be directly lifted to a storage chamber deck, so that the passage space is influenced due to the overlarge opening, and an in-industry conventional method is to increase movable railing posts and string steel wire rope fences, so that the operation is complex, and the steel wire rope fences are unstable.
Disclosure of Invention
The invention aims to solve the problems and provides a sunk liftable fence for a ship deck opening, which is convenient to operate and store and has good stability and safety of the fence.

Detailed Description
The invention will be further explained with reference to the drawings.
Referring to fig. 1 to 3, which illustrate a sunk liftable enclosure for a ship deck opening according to the present invention, the ship deck opening 1 is a rounded rectangular shape and includes a sunk opening having a circle of enclosure walls 11, the upper edges of the enclosure walls 11 and a ship deck form a circle of step structure 12, and two steel grid plates 13 capable of being spliced are mounted on the step structure 12, the sunk liftable enclosure includes:
a sunk base 2 parallel to the ship deck and arranged on the bottom edge of the enclosure wall 11, wherein the sunk base 2 is provided with a circle of rounded rectangular sunk base opening 21;
four lifting bases 3 which are respectively arranged on the submerged base 2 and close to the four edges of the opening 21 of the submerged base;
the four lower ends of the four lifting bases are respectively hinged with diamond-shaped lifting rods 4 arranged on the four lifting bases 3;
a circle of high-level rods 5 which are movably arranged at the top ends of the rhombic lifting rods 4 are arranged in parallel with the ship deck;
two circles of middle rods 6 which are arranged below the high-level rod 5 in parallel and connected with the rhombic lifting rod 4;
two brace rod bases 7 which are diagonally arranged on the surrounding wall 11;
the two support rods 8 are respectively rotatably installed on the support rod base 7, a bolt 81 with a tongue is installed at the upper end of each support rod 8, the rotation angle of each support rod 8 is 0-90 degrees, when the movement angle of each support rod 8 is 0 degree, the support rod 8 is located in the ship deck opening 1, when the movement angle of each support rod 8 is 90 degrees, the upper end of each support rod 8 is higher than the ship deck opening 1 and is vertical to the ship deck, and at the moment, the high-position rod 5 can be installed in the bolt 81 with the tongue;
and water blocking round steel 9 is arranged on the edge of the ship deck at the opening 1 of the ship deck.
The stay bar 8 of the invention is a reversible support and can be used for supporting a raised fence, the space between the three-gear railings of the fence refers to the load line convention requirement, the stay bar 8 is placed after the bolt with tongue is pulled out, the three-gear railings of the fence can be lowered to the submerged base 2 through the rhombic lifting rod 4, the fence is stored on the submerged base 2, referring to fig. 4, a steel grating plate 13 can be laid above the ship deck opening 1, the deck aisle space is not influenced, and the invention has the characteristics of convenient operation and good use effect.
